import { Serializer } from "@/serializer/serializer.js";
import { ClassConstructor, PromiseOrPlain } from "@/internals/types.js";
import * as R from "remeda";
import { extractClassName } from "@/serializer/utils.js";
import { SerializerError } from "@/serializer/error.js";
import { Cache } from "@/cache/decoratorCache.js";
export type SerializableClass<T> = ClassConstructor<Serializable<T>> &
Pick<typeof Serializable<T>, "fromSnapshot" | "fromSerialized">;
interface SerializableStructure<T> {
target: string;
snapshot: T;
}
interface DeserializeOptions {
extraClasses?: SerializableClass<unknown>[];
}
export abstract class Serializable<T = unknown> {
abstract createSnapshot(): T;
abstract loadSnapshot(snapshot: T): void;
constructor() {
Object.getPrototypeOf(this).constructor.register();
Cache.init(this);
}
protected static register<T>(this: SerializableClass<T>, aliases?: string[]) {
Serializer.registerSerializable(this, undefined, aliases);
}
clone<T extends Serializable>(this: T): T {
const snapshot = this.createSnapshot();
const target = Object.create(this.constructor.prototype);
target.loadSnapshot(snapshot);
return target;
}
serialize(): string {
const snapshot = this.createSnapshot();
return Serializer.serialize<SerializableStructure<T>>({
target: extractClassName(this),
snapshot,
});
}
protected deserialize(value: string, options?: DeserializeOptions): T {
const { __root } = Serializer.deserializeWithMeta<SerializableStructure<T>>(
value,
options?.extraClasses,
);
if (!__root.target) {
// eslint-disable-next-line
console.warn(
`Serializable class must be serialized via "serialize" method and not via Serializer class. This may lead to incorrect deserialization.`,
);
return __root as T;
}
const current = extractClassName(this);
if (current !== __root.target) {
throw new SerializerError(
`Snapshot has been created for class '${__root.target}' but you want to use it for class '${current}'.`,
);
}
return __root.snapshot;
}
static fromSnapshot<T, P>(
this: new (...args: any[]) => T extends Serializable<P> ? T : never,
state: P,
): T {
const target = Object.create(this.prototype);
target.loadSnapshot(state);
Cache.init(target);
return target;
}
static fromSerialized<T extends Serializable>(
this: abstract new (...args: any[]) => T,
serialized: string,
options: DeserializeOptions = {},
): PromiseOrPlain<T, T["loadSnapshot"]> {
const target = Object.create(this.prototype) as T;
const state = target.deserialize(serialized, options);
const load = target.loadSnapshot(state);
Cache.init(target);
return (R.isPromise(load) ? load.then(() => target) : target) as PromiseOrPlain<
T,
T["loadSnapshot"]
>;
}
}
